William H. (Bookie) Boekholder of Mountain Home passed away Thursday, October 13, 2022 at his home. He was born September 1, 1936 in Freeport, IL to the late Gerald and Margaret Boekholder.
William graduated from Dubuque Senior High School in Dubuque, Iowa in 1955. He then served in the United States Air Force from 1955-1959. He married Theresa M. Wewers on April 23, 1960 in Fort Smith, AR. To this union 2 children were born, Deborah and William.
He spent many years in the Boy Scouts, earning the St. George Award for Catholic Scouting, the Silver Beaver and Vigil Member of the Order of the Arrow. He was a lifetime member of The Knights of Columbus rising to the level of Forth Degree. He was employed by Goodyear Tire and Rubber for 28 years.
After moving to Mountain Home in October 2000, he has been a volunteer at the Mountain Home Christian Clinic.
